Sausage Pepper Calzones

  1. Crumble sausage into a
  2. ; add the onion, peppers and 2 teaspoons oil. Cook over medium heat until meat is no longer pink.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Drain.
  3. Stir in the sherry, vinegar, salt, pepper and 1 teaspoon each oregano and rosemary; heat through.
  4. Divide each loaf of dough into six portions. On a floured surface, roll each portion into a 6-in. circle. Brush with remaining oil; sprinkle with remaining oregano and rosemary.
  5. Spread 1 tablespoon pizza sauce over each circle. Spoon about 1/4 cup sausage mixture on half of each circle to within 1/2 in. of edges; fold dough over filling and seal edges. Cut a small slit in top.
  6. Sprinkle cornmeal over greased
  7. . Place calzones on
  8. . Cover and let rise in a warm place for 30 minutes.
  9. Bake at 400u0b0 for 12-15 minutes or until golden brown. Warm remaining pizza sauce; serve with calzones.

sausage, onion, peppers, olive oil, garlic, sherry, balsamic vinegar, salt, pepper, fresh oregano, fresh rosemary, loaves, pizza sauce, cornmeal
